Question:
I'm a veteran and get my dental work done for free.
However I recently let one of their dentists grind on my upper plate right in the middle on the very top of the denture in front. She ground out an area about 1/8th an inch wide and about 3/16th of an inch down. It made the denture almost impossible to use without pain.
The denture really wasn't bad at all till this was done. Can the area she ground away be put back, Kinda a patch job? ... Visitor from OK
Answer:
Ask the dentist to do a "chairside reline". That will repair the damage and make the denture fit properly.
My concern is that "free" dentists typically do as little work as possible and they may not wish to take the time to help you.
